    It would have worked in one sense because Mantle's Prime card is by most accounts the most famous Topps card in history.

    But Mantle (like Mays and Ruth before him and Aaron after him) is a major sales driver whose mere presence in the game can really get folks excited. Wagner, despite him having the most famous baseball card ever and a Top 10 Career WAR, wasn't going to sell a ton of discs.

    ... On the flip side, if we're using "Famousness of a baseball card" to help determine who the collection will be, then Billy Ripken would have to be considered a heavy favorite. (Google it, kids)
